    K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• The Glass Manager is to safely build the required quality product efficiently and on time with an eye to minimizing waste and overall cost.
    • They will develop an environment of success where people willingly bring their best every day.
    • They will drive consistent process deployment within their manufacturing area while working to achieve site KPI metrics.
    • They will share and learn from best practices within the site and the larger Mfg Operations team.
    • Supervises the activities of their team.  Reviews and troubleshoots process and equipment problems with Operators, EOL, maintenance and EHS if needed.
    • Addresses employee concerns and hold the team to a high standard. Coaches and implements corrective action by working with site leadership / HR in a timely manner.
    • Maintains and enforces housekeeping and safety procedures, including site-specific Emergency Response programs.  Participates in safety audits and inspections.
    • Uses Lean methodologies including visual management and root cause tools to effectively solve problems
    • Provide training and leadership to the department members. Participate in and/or closely monitor the on-the-job training of new or newly assigned employees.  In conjunction with the Manufacturing Plant Manager develop training plans for all employees and communicate them to each employee at least annually.  Report on progress as requested.
    • Assist in creation of career progression system within the line and site with the goal of cross training to improve both the employee experience and the end product.
    • Maintain an accident-free workplace while complying with OSHA standards.

    REPORTING RELATIONSHIPS:

    The Glass Manager will report to the Plant Manager. They will be a key member of the Manufacturing Plant Operations Team.

    They will have close working relationships with the Production Manager/ Plant Superintendent, Supply Chain Manager, Maintenance Manager, Manufacturing Engineers, Quality Manager, HR Manager, EHS Manager and other key Supervisors and support (HR, Finance, etc.) staff.

    Additional Information

    Associated Materials is a leader in exterior building products for residential and commercial remodeling and new construction markets. We produce vinyl windows, vinyl and composite siding and accessories, and metal building products—and distribute other essential building products to ensure customers find everything they need for their exterior. 

    Headquartered in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io, more than 4,000 associates across North America support Associated Materials. We operate 11 manufacturing facilities and more than 100 Alside and over 20 Gentek supply centers across the United States and Canada.
